The Epithelial Sodium Channel and the Processes of Wound Healing

Figure 5

Possible effects of ENaC activation on the healing process. The scheme summarizes some effects of the increase in ENaC expression and/or activity. The direct consequences of the channel stimulation are an elevation in intracellular sodium and plasma membrane depolarization (represented by smaller plus and minus symbols). The scheme also suggests a possible effect on the cytoskeletal organization provoked by the ionic and electrical changes. In a secondary fashion, the rise in intracellular sodium and plasma membrane depolarization determine the reverse mode of operation of the sodium-calcium exchanger (NCX) with the consequent rise in cytosolic calcium. The sodium and calcium increases constitute signals that modulate diverse cellular processes.
